March 29, 2012 BIR RULING NO. 229-12 Sec. 40 (C) (2) of NIRC of 1997; RR 18-01 DLC Holdings, Corp. 70 Calamba St.,Sta. Mesa Heights, Quezon City Attention: Ms. Maureen C. Abelardo Treasurer Gentlemen : This is to acknowledge receipt of your letter request (consisting of 2 folders) dated January 31, 2011, on behalf of DLC HOLDINGS, CORP., requesting confirmation of a tax-free exchange transaction pursuant to Section 40 (C) (2) the Tax Code of 1997 involving the transfer of a real properties of DOROTEO L. CORONEL AND DOLORES B. CORONEL to the aforementioned corporation, in exchange for its shares of stocks. Documents submitted disclosed the following facts: 1. Spouses Doroteo L. Coronel and Dolores B. Coronel are stockholders of DLC HOLDINGS, CORP. and are the registered owners of a residential house and lot covered by Transfer Certificate of Title No. (TCT) N-173012 located at Sta. Mesa Heights, Quezon City; 2. DLC HOLDINGS, CORP. is a domestic corporation registered with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) under SEC Registration No. ASO9301324 dated February 18, 1993; 3. DLC HOLDINGS, CORP.,upon incorporation had Four Million Pesos (P4,000,000.00) authorized capital stock, divided into forty thousand (40,000) common shares with One Hundred Pesos (P100.00) par value per share; aASDTE 4. On September 3, 2010, DLC HOLDINGS, CORP. increased its authorized capital stock from P4,000,000.00 to P14,000,000.00, divided into 140,000 common stock at P100 par value per share. 5. According to paragraph 3 of the Certificate of Approval of Increase of Capital Stock of DLC HOLDINGS, CORP. issued by the SEC, the net increase in the authorized capital stock of Ten Million Pesos (P10,000,000.00) the amount of P10,000,000.00 has been actually subscribed by the subscribers-stockholders and of the said subscription, Eight Million One Hundred Fifty Six Thousand One Hundred Eighty Five Pesos (P8,156,185.00) has been actually paid via conversion of liabilities into equity. 6. Documentary stamp tax for the issuance of shares as a result of the conversion has been paid on October 22, 2010. 7. Spouses Doroteo L. Coronel and Dolores B. Coronel have decided to transfer and exchange their residential house and lot to DLC HOLDINGS, CORP. in for its shares of stock under the provisions of Section 40 (C) (2) of the Tax Code of 1997. In reply, please be informed that the tax-free exchange transaction between spouses Doroteo L. Coronel and Dolores B. Coronel and DLC HOLDINGS, CORP. cannot be given due course on the ground that the latter corporation has no more shares of stock to issue in exchange of the real property being assigned by the spouses. It appears from the List of Stockholders 1 reported by the DLC HOLDINGS, CORP. Corporate Secretary of Record as of March 18, 2010, that the whole authorized capital stock has been subscribed by the following stockholders and the amount of subscription paid up: IcHAaS Name of Subscriber Subscribed Amount Paid No. of Shares Amount Doroteo L. Coronel 10,000 P1,000,000.00 P625,000.00 Dolores B. Coronel 10,000 1,000,000.00 625,000.00 Maureen C. Abelardo 4,000 400,000.00 250,000.00 Evangeline C. Torres 4,000 400,000.00 250,000.00 Leopoldo B. Coronel 4,000 400,000.00 250,000.00 Doroteo B. Coronel, Jr. 4,000 400,000.00 250,000.00 Ma. Angelita Nichols 4,000 400,000.00 250,000.00 Total 40,000 P4,000,000.00 P2,500,000.00 ====== =========== =========== Upon increase of the authorized capital stock, the whole net increase equivalent to P10,000,000.00 has been subscribed via conversion of liabilities into equity. It is clear that the stockholders have subscribed to DLC HOLDINGS, CORP.'s whole authorized capital stock as well as to the increase in capital stock, hence, there are no unissued shares left which the corporation can issue in exchange for the real property being transferred by the spouses Coronel. Thus, this Office cannot grant your request to confirm a tax-free exchange transaction between spouses Doroteo L. Coronel and Dolores B. Coronel and DLC HOLDINGS, CORP. pursuant to Section 40 (C) (2) of the Tax Code of 1997, as amended and Revenue Regulations No. 18-01 (Guidelines on the Monitoring of the Basis of Property Transferred and Shares Received, Pursuant to a Tax-Free Exchange of Property for Shares under Section 40 (C) (2) of the National Internal Revenue Code of 1997, Prescribing the Penalties for Failure to Comply with such Guidelines, and Authorizing the Imposition of Fees for the Monitoring Thereof) . AScTaD This ruling is being issued on the basis of the foregoing facts as represented. However, if upon investigation, it will be disclosed that the facts as represented are different, then this ruling shall be considered null and void. Very truly yours, (SGD.) KIM S.
